From 9af4b9523483224e120c2559dff1d89874923e52 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Daniel=20Ekl=C3=B6f?= Date: Sat, 1 Jan 2022 14:14:17 +0100 Subject: [PATCH] doc: ctlseq: kitty keyboard protocol --- doc/foot-ctlseqs.7.scd |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/doc/foot-ctlseqs.7.scd b/doc/foot-ctlseqs.7.scd index f64b3b20..9cd6bf18 100644 --- a/doc/foot-ctlseqs.7.scd +++ b/doc/foot-ctlseqs.7.scd @@ -557,6 +557,23 @@ manipulation sequences. The generic format is: : xterm : _Ps_=0 -> report terminal name and version, in the form *\\EP>|foot(version)\\E\\*. +| \\E ? u +: kitty +: +: Query current values of the Kitty keyboard flags. +| \\E > _flags_ u +: kitty +: +: Push a new entry, _flags_, to the Kitty keyboard stack. +| \\E < _number_ u +: kitty +: +: Pop _number_ of entries from the Kitty keyboard stack. +| \\E = _flags_ ; _mode_ u +: kitty +: +: Update current Kitty keyboard flags, according to _mode_. + # OSC